Castello di Tassarolo

Castello di Tassarolo sits in Piemonte, the northern Italian region celebrated for its distinctive white and red wines. The winery produces Gavi from Cortese, the pale, mineral-driven white that defines the area's cooler zones. Spinola Gavi, the flagship expression, balances the variety's natural acidity with subtle fruit character. Il Castello Gavi offers a complementary take on the same grape. The winery also makes Rosa Spinola Monferrato Chiaretto, a rosé built from Nebbiolo, the dark-skinned variety more commonly seen as Piemonte's serious reds. Wines from Castello di Tassarolo have been reviewed by Wine Spectator, Wine Enthusiast, Decanter, and Wine Advocate.
